Ornie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Ornie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Ornie is held by more people in The United States than any other country/territory. It can also be rendered as a variant:. Click here to see other potential spellings of this last name.
How Common Is The Last Name Ornie? popularity and diffusion
It is the 5,391,485th most commonly occurring last name on a global scale, held by approximately 1 in 560,580,455 people. The surname Ornie occ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Ornie reside; 100 percent reside in North America and 100 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Ornie is also the 646,152nd most commonly used first name throughout the world, held by 197 people.
The last name is most frequently occurring in The United States, where it is held by 13 people, or 1 in 27,881,456. In The United States Ornie is primarily found in: Oregon, where 100 percent reside.
Ornie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Ornie has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Ornie last name expanded 217 percent between 1880 and 2014.
